Chelsea’s transfer ban lifted by CAS
The Court of Arbitration for Sport (CAS) found in Chelsea’s favour after FIFA had banned them from signing any new players until 2011 as punishment for allegedly inducing Kakuta to break his contract with Lens.
Chelsea chairman Bruce Buck said: “We are pleased to have come to an amicable resolution of the matter and that it has been ratified by CAS and recognised by FIFA.”
